Are you an experienced Field Service Engineer with a passion for scientific and analytical instrumentation? As a Field Service Engineer, you’ll be responsible for the installation, maintenance, and technical support of advanced laboratory instruments, initially focusing on laser diffraction and dispersion technology, with the opportunity to expand into X-ray instrumentation after training.

  • Service & Maintenance – Install, repair, and maintain analytical instruments for customers in raw materials and manufacturing industries.
  • Customer Support – Provide hands-on technical assistance and training.
  • Travel & Autonomy – Cover a regional area with 4–5 days of travel per week, typically staying away 2–3 nights per week.
  • Self-Management – Own your schedule, travel, and customer appointments.
  • Team Collaboration – Work closely with a highly experienced team, backed by strong technical and administrative support.

Requirements:

  • HNC / HND or Degree in Engineering, Physics, or Chemistry with Electronics knowledge (a must for X-ray systems).
  • Field Service experience with scientific, analytical, or industrial instrumentation (biomedical alone may not be suitable).
  • Ability to work independently, self-organize, and handle frequent travel.
